What is a HICLOVER Waste Incinerator and how does it operate?
The HICLOVER waste incinerator is a state-of-the-art facility designed for the efficient treatment of **hospital waste**. This **incinerator for hospital waste treatment** meets stringent industrial standards by achieving combustion temperatures ranging from 850°C to 1200°C. The design emphasizes **engineering reliability** and incorporates a dual-chamber configuration, which ensures complete combustion of hazardous materials while minimizing emissions. The incinerator’s operational framework is aligned with global regulations, including WHO guidelines and European Union emission frameworks, contributing to its effectiveness in managing infectious and hazardous waste.
What are the key features of HICLOVER waste incinerators?
HICLOVER waste incinerators are marked by several technical characteristics that enhance their functionality:
- Dual Combustion Chambers: This design allows for an initial combustion phase with a secondary chamber that ensures complete burning of byproducts, thereby reducing harmful emissions.
- High Temperature Retention: Maintaining elevated temperatures is crucial for the destruction of pathogens and toxic substances, ensuring that waste treatment meets international safety standards.
- Multiple Fuel Options: The incinerators can operate on various fuels, including diesel, LPG, and natural gas, offering flexibility depending on the operational context.
- PLC Automation: Advanced automation through PLC (Programmable Logic Controller) enhances operational efficiency and reliability, allowing for precise control over the combustion process.
- Optional Scrubbing Systems: HICLOVER offers both wet and dry scrubbers, which significantly reduce particulate matter and other pollutants released into the atmosphere.

How do HICLOVER waste incinerators compare to other waste management technologies?
When comparing **HICLOVER waste incinerators** to other waste management technologies, several factors stand out:
- Fixed vs. Containerized Systems: While fixed incinerators require permanent infrastructure, containerized models offer mobility and adaptability, making them ideal for locations with fluctuating waste volumes.
- Control Mechanisms: The choice between PLC and manual control systems depends on the operational needs, with PLC systems offering superior automation and monitoring capabilities.
- Scrubbing Systems: The decision to implement dry scrubbers versus wet scrubbers is often based on local regulations and the specific types of waste being processed, with HICLOVER providing tailored solutions.
